A MAN has been arrested on suspicion of murder following the death of a 21-year-old.

At 2.50am today, Saturday, officers were called to a property on Wilderspool Causeway and found a man with serious injuries.  

An ambulance attended the scene and the man was taken to Warrington Hospital where he died a short time later. 

DI Adam Waller, of Cheshire Police’s Major Investigation Team, said: “At this stage the incident appears to be isolated and enquiries are ongoing to establish the exact circumstances of what took place.

“A 31-year-old man has been arrested on suspicion of murder and will be assisting officers with their investigation.

“I would urge anyone who may have witnessed what happened, saw anything suspicious or unusual,  or has any information which could assist officers with their enquiries, to contact us on 101.”



A formal identification of the man has not yet taken place. 

Witnesses have reported forensic vans at the scene this morning and a police cordon has been put in place near the junction with Fletcher Street.

Traffic is still able to travel down Wilderspool Causeway in both directions.

Officers remain in the area to provide reassurance to the community and anyone with any issues or concerns is urged to speak to an officer.
